Sonda - Bamori, Guna

Sonda is a village situated in the Bamori tehsil of Guna district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 35 km from the tehsil headquarters in Bamori and around 65 km from the district headquarters in Guna. Pathi serves as the Gram Panchayat for Sonda village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Sonda is 499079. The village covers a total geographical area of 149 hectares and falls under the 473105 pincode. Guna is the nearest town, located about 65 km away.

Sonda village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Bamori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Guna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Sonda

As per Census 2011, Sonda village has a total population of 258 people, consisting of 129 males and 129 females. The village has 46 households and a sex ratio of 1,000 females per 1,000 males. There are 59 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 79 literate and 179 illiterate residents.

Detailed gender-wise population figures for Sonda are given below:

CategoryTotalMaleFemale
Total Population258129129
Child Population (0–6 yrs)593227
Literate Population794831
Illiterate Population1798198

Transport and Connectivity of Sonda

Public transport facilities are available within 2-5 km of the Sonda.

ConnectivityStatusNearest Availability
Public Bus ServiceNoAvailable within 5-10 km
Private Bus ServiceNoAvailable within 5-10 km
Railway StationNo-

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Guna to Sonda is about 65 km, with a usual travel time of around ~1.9 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
